Most people like cooking, but hate cleaning the kitchen. However, it’s important to maintain you kitchen clean because it keeps you and your family safer and healthier. Also, it’s more motivating and easier to bake and cook in a clean environment. We we’ll share some preventive measures and tips on how to maintain your kitchen cleanliness. Cleaning cannot be avoided, but this measures and tips will help you spend less time, money and energy on cleaning your cooking environment. You should have a place to store everything. When an appliance or utensil has a “home”, it’s easier to use it, clean it and, at the end, put it away. Every experienced interior designer knows that the most complicated space to design in a house is exactly the kitchen. So, if you are a homeowner, it’s completely normal to feel lost and confused, especially if you are trying to figure out how to design the kitchen island. We will try to help you. Let’s make it clear: there is no set formula for figuring the size and shape of an island, there are only some useful tips and measurement guidelines. First of all, you need to ask yourself 5 basic questions. 1. What is the function of your kitchen island? Of course, islands are multifunctional, but you have to decide its main function. Whether you are building a new or renovating your old kitchen, you might be considering granite benchtops. Well, nobody can’t blame you since nothing compares to the beauty and elegance of stone kitchen benchtops. If you are looking for a really good material to use, granite is among the ones with the highest quality on the market. Compared to other materials, such as wood and plastic, used for a kitchen benchtop, granite has some significant advantages. Granit benchtops come in variety of colors and styles, so it’s easy to choose the one that will fit beautiful in your own setting. For these reasons, granite benchtops are worth spending some extra money to get the best for your kitchen.
